Single dads projected to grow by 70% by G_rodriguez69 in australia

[–]el_stry 54 points55 points  (0 children)

"Lone-parent families are projected to make up about one-quarter of households by 2046, with male lone-parent families increasing at the "fastest rate" — by between 40 per cent and 69 per cent.

But single-female-parent households will remain dominant, making up around 80 per cent of all single-parent households, according to the bureau's projections."

Researchers hope footage of mass stranding on Cheynes Beach could help understand why whales beach themselves by el_stry in WesternAustralia

[–]el_stry[S] 2 points3 points  (0 children)

They don't know for sure, but some of these theories are super interesting. Especially this one:

Griffith University research fellow Olaf Meynecke, said pilot whales are some of the most emotional animals on the planet — and it is possible their huge capacity for emotion is behind the stranding behaviours.
"I'm very certain that the majority of the whales were very, very well aware of the dangers of being so close to shore," Dr Meynecke said.
